How to find dentists accepting KanCare (Medicaid):
- All children enrolled in KanCare have dental coverage. For help finding a dentist for your child, use the Find a Dentist for Your Kid search tool on the federal CMS website at this link: www.insurekidsnow.gov/coverage/find-a-dentist/index.html
- Adults with KanCare insurance can receive dental exams and cleanings at least once per year. In addition, United Healthcare will provide one x-ray per year and those with a FE waiver may be eligible to receive dentures at no cost. Tooth extractions may be covered if they are considered medically necessary.
- Call the phone number on your health insurance card to find out how to find a dentist near you who takes your insurance.
- Be sure to let your dentist know that you’re enrolled in KanCare or give them the name of your health plan when you make an appointment for care.
- If you’re having trouble getting an appointment to see a dental care provider, call the KMAP Customer Service Center at 1-800-766-9012 or your health plan’s member services department for help.
